Manny Smith today revealed Walsall have gone into overdrive to solve their winter woes and insisted the team are still "winners".
The defender admitted the Saddlers are putting in extra hours to end a run which has seen them win just twice in 18 games.
Saturday's 1-1 FA Cup draw with Dagenham extended their unbeaten run to three games and, with Walsall in the League One drop zone, Smith insisted they are working overtime.
"In training everyone is buzzing, everyone comes in early and everyone is doing extra – we just don't want to lose," he said – ahead of Saturday's visit of leaders Charlton. "If the worst comes to the worse we'll end up with a draw but we don't want to lose games.
"The fact we're three unbeaten is more to take but we've got to turn the draws into wins. But the longer we aren't losing then that's a positive.
"All the boys are winners. Even when the odds are against us we still work hard and play together as a team."
